Now that the fictional guests of season three of The White Lotus have officially checked out of their sumptuous Thai resort, the country is gearing up for the real tourists to arrive.

The series recently wrapped filming at several resorts and locations in Thailand, and although the show probably will not air until next year, hotels and tour operators are readying for their own White Lotus bump.

The first two seasons of the show, a satirical look at the lives of the employees of the eponymous luxury hotel chain and of its wealthy guests, were filmed at Four Seasons properties in Maui, Hawaii and the Sicilian town of Taormina. Fans turned those real-life resorts and cities into bucket-list destinations, spurring an avalanche of visitors.

Some tourists are getting in before the next season’s airing.

“You still can’t get into the Four Seasons in Taormina – it’s completely chock-a-block,” says Misty Belles, spokeswoman for Virtuoso, a global network for some 20,000 luxury advisers.
